Jquery 滑入/滑出a<;TD>;

Jquery 滑入/滑出a<;TD>;,jquery,jquery-ui,Jquery,Jquery Ui,我有一个TD,目前在页面的左侧。我想让TD滑入滑出(带动画)。 .animate可与div一起使用,但不能与TD一起使用。有什么好办法吗?没有,没有 表格单元格应该是表格的一部分,如果您试图将其放置在其他位置,它将无法正常工作。不,不太可能 表格单元应该是表格的一部分,如果您尝试将其放置在其他位置,它将无法正常工作。td由于元素集成到表格模型中的方式,很难设置动画。我强烈建议使用放置在td中的div <table> <tr> <td>

我有一个TD,目前在页面的左侧。我想让TD滑入滑出(带动画)。 .animate可与div一起使用,但不能与TD一起使用。有什么好办法吗?

没有,没有

表格单元格应该是表格的一部分,如果您试图将其放置在其他位置,它将无法正常工作。

不,不太可能


表格单元应该是表格的一部分,如果您尝试将其放置在其他位置,它将无法正常工作。

td
由于元素集成到表格模型中的方式,很难设置动画。我强烈建议使用放置在
td
中的
div

<table>
    <tr>
        <td>
            <div>Foo</div> <!-- animate this element instead -->
        </td>
    </tr>
</table>

或者更好的是,不要使用表格。

td
由于元素集成到表格模型中的方式,它们很难设置动画。我强烈建议使用放置在
td
中的
div

<table>
    <tr>
        <td>
            <div>Foo</div> <!-- animate this element instead -->
        </td>
    </tr>
</table>

或者更好的是,不要使用表。

我建议在DIV上使用相对定位——在-400或某处启动它,然后将它恢复到零。@ BraseMuner-Enter我确实考虑添加,但是它将取决于OP正在做的动画类型。我知道当任何其他TR的相邻TD具有较大的宽度时,这个想法是行不通的。但就目前而言,它的工作是:我建议在DIV上使用相对定位——开始在-400或某处,然后把它恢复到零。@ BraseMung.我确实考虑添加这个,但是它将取决于OP正在做的动画类型。我知道当任何其他TR的相邻TD都有较大的宽度时,这个想法是行不通的。但就目前而言,它的工作是:你问这个问题是因为你在使用一个表格来进行网站布局吗?请说不。不幸的是我没有写HTML。我必须说那个HTML的家伙疯了。想象!他用桌子里的桌子,然后是另一张桌子,然后是另一张桌子,依此类推:(哦,伙计,我不羡慕你。总是粗暴地处理遗留代码!你问这个问题是因为你正在使用一个表来进行网站布局吗?请说不。不幸的是,我没有编写HTML。我必须说,HTML的家伙疯了。想象一下!他使用了表内的表,然后是另一个表,然后是另一个表等等:(哦,老兄,我不羡慕你。总是粗暴对待遗留代码!